C8051F52x-53x  
The level of Flash security depends on the Flash access method. The three Flash access methods that  
can be restricted are reads, writes, and erases from the C2 debug interface, user firmware executing on  
unlocked pages, and user firmware executing on locked pages.  
Accessing Flash from the C2 debug interface:  
1. Any unlocked page may be read, written, or erased.  
2. Locked pages cannot be read, written, or erased.  
3. The page containing the Lock Byte may be read, written, or erased if it is unlocked.  
4. Reading the contents of the Lock Byte is always permitted only if no pages are locked.  
5. Locking additional pages (changing ‘1’s to ‘0’s in the Lock Byte) is not permitted.  
6. Unlocking Flash pages (changing ‘0’s to ‘1’s in the Lock Byte) requires the C2 Device Erase  
command, which erases all Flash pages including the page containing the Lock Byte and the  
Lock Byte itself.  
7. The Reserved Area cannot be read, written, or erased.  
Accessing Flash from user firmware executing from an unlocked page:  
1. Any unlocked page except the page containing the Lock Byte may be read, written, or erased.  
2. Locked pages cannot be read, written, or erased. An erase attempt on the page containing the  
Lock Byte will result in a Flash Error device reset.  
3. The page containing the Lock Byte cannot be erased. It may be read or written only if it is  
unlocked. An erase attempt on the page containing the Lock Byte will result in a Flash Error  
device reset.  
4. Reading the contents of the Lock Byte is always permitted.  
5. Locking additional pages (changing ‘1’s to ‘0’s in the Lock Byte) is not permitted.  
6. Unlocking Flash pages (changing ‘0’s to ‘1’s in the Lock Byte) is not permitted.  
7. The Reserved Area cannot be read, written, or erased. Any attempt to access the reserved  
area, or any other locked page, will result in a Flash Error device reset.  
Accessing Flash from user firmware executing from a locked page:  
1. Any unlocked page except the page containing the Lock Byte may be read, written, or erased.  
2. Any locked page except the page containing the Lock Byte may be read, written, or erased. An  
erase attempt on the page containing the Lock Byte will result in a Flash Error device reset.  
3. The page containing the Lock Byte cannot be erased. It may only be read or written. An  
erase attempt on the page containing the Lock Byte will result in a Flash Error device reset.  
4. Reading the contents of the Lock Byte is always permitted.  
5. Locking additional pages (changing ‘1’s to ‘0’s in the Lock Byte) is not permitted.  
6. Unlocking Flash pages (changing ‘0’s to ‘1’s in the Lock Byte) is not permitted.  
7. The Reserved Area cannot be read, written, or erased. Any attempt to access the reserved  
area, or any other locked page, will result in a Flash Error device reset.
